Your Roth IRA balance at retirement is predicated around the components you plug in on the calculator — your total planned once-a-year contribution, your present age and retirement age and the rate of return. The Roth IRA calculator assumes 2% annual income growth. There isn't any inflation assumption.

There's a area that permits you to alter withholdings for dependents, which can assist you if you're planning to claim the kid Tax Credit history (CTC) with the year. The CTC can be a partly refundable tax credit rating worth $2,000 for each qualifying little one under the age of seventeen, and it really works as a dollar-for-greenback reduction of the tax Invoice.

The twin advantages of tax-free withdrawals and no RMDs gain retirees in additional strategies. These benefits make it less difficult and even more tax-effective to go away dollars to heirs, Together with offering adaptability when building money-stream decisions in retirement, personal finance execs say.
